Näsijärvi

Getting around: Borders central Tampere on its northern side; harbor cruises depart from the city center.
Hours: Open year-round; cruises run seasonally, mainly May-September.

Nasijarvi is the lake bordering Tampere's northern side, one of two major lakes (with Pyhajarvi) that give Tampere its distinctive isthmus setting between two large bodies of water connected by rapids. Historic steamboat cruises run from the city center in summer, some heading toward the Sarkanniemi area or further afield.

It functions mainly as a scenic backdrop and cruise destination rather than a swimming lake within the city itself.

How does it relate to Tampere's setting?

Tampere sits on an isthmus between Nasijarvi and Pyhajarvi, connected by rapids that historically powered the city's industry.
